    Trailer question.....2001

    Does anyone know what size rim and bolt pattern the trailers for the 2001 came with? 89 model if it makes a difference.
  • Hollywood
    1,000 Post Club Member
    • Sep 2003
    • 1930

    • WIIL


    #2
    RE: Trailer question.....2001

    Don't believe '89 should be any different than '88.
    6 x 5.5" bolt pattern
    15" diameter

    6" width???
    backspacing is probably 2"???
